Slenderscratch Italic Description

This font features a dynamic, handwritten style with an italic slant, giving it an energetic and expressive appearance. The strokes are bold and varied, with a scratchy texture that adds a sense of urgency and movement. The characters are slightly condensed, enhancing the overall compact feel. The uppercase and lowercase letters maintain a consistent flow, while the numerals and special characters integrate seamlessly into the design. This font's unique style makes it stand out, perfect for projects that require a personal touch or a sense of spontaneity.
